"SEAN has undertaken the complex task of creating a single economic entity for Southeast Asia by 2015 in the form of the ASEAN Economic Community (AEC), but without regulators or supranational institutions, its implementation has been an inconsistent process. Through comparisons with the EU and NAFTA, this book illustrates the shortcomings of the current system, enabling readers to understand both the potential of regional economic development in ASEAN and its foundational and institutional deficiencies. The authors' analysis of trade in goods and services, investment, and dispute resolution in the AEC indicates that without strong regional institutions, strong dispute resolution or a set of norms, full and effective implementation of the AEC is unlikely to result. The book offers clear solutions for the ASEAN institutions to help the AEC reach its full potential. Written by two leading practitioners, this insightful book will interest policymakers, students and researchers"--"

"ABSTRAK
Tujuan penulisan penelitian ini secara garis besar adalah, pertama, untuk mengetahui permasalahan-permasalahan yang dihadapi oleh peritel tradisional Indonesia berdasarkan ratio decidendi putusan-putusan KPPU. Kedua, tulisan ini ingin mengetahui bagaimana pengaturan hukum ritel tradisional Indonesia, dan ketiga, penulis ingin melihat bagaimana prospek perlindungan hukum ritel indonesia dalam menghadapi Masyarakat Ekonomi ASEAN setelah sebelumnya dibandingkan dengan kondisi perlindungan hukum ritel tradisional di Thailand secara singkat. Metode penelitian yang penulis gunakan adalah normatif dengan kajian literatur yang didukung dengan pendekatan perundang-undangan, konseptual, putusan, serta perbandingan.
Penulis mengidentifikasikan bahwa pada dasarnya isu perlindungan hukum bagi ritel tradisional Indonesia memiliki kesamaan dengan ritel tradisional di Thailand yaitu persaingan secara langsung dengan ritel besar modern. Respon pemerintah Thailand adalah dengan menerbitkan undang-undang khusus di bidang ritel serta adanya Code of Ethic. Persaingan secara lansung antara ritel tradisional dan besar modern di Indonesia terjadi karena berkaitan dengan regulasi dan efektivitas zonasi, aturan jam buka layanan, rendahnya kompetensi pedagang serta pengelolaan pasar, dan juga berkaitan dengan lemahnya ruang lingkup kewenangan KPPU serta kurang efektifnya penegakan perlindungan hukum.
Berdasarkan masalah yang telah diidentifikasikan sebelumnya, untuk menghadapi Masyarakat Ekonomi ASEAN diperlukan penguatan kewenangan KPPU dan revisi Undang-Undang Nomor 5 Tahun 1999. Selain itu, untuk meningkatkan posisi tawar peritel tradisional Indonesia sebaiknya memiliki asosiasi atau perkumpulan yang dapat merespon permasalahan ?permasalahan yang dihadapi.

ABSTRACT
The purpose of writing this paper are, first, to find out the problems faced by Indonesian traditional retailers based on ratio decidendi in Commission's decisions. Secondly, this paper wants to know how the law regulate Indonesian traditional retail industry, and third, the authors wanted to see how the prospects for legal protection of Indonesian traditional retail industry in the ASEAN Economic Community as compared to the previous condition of the legal protection of traditional retailing in Thailand. The research method that I use is normative literature review supported with the statute approach, and conceptual, decision, as well as a comparison approach.
The authors identified that basically the issue of legal protection for traditional retail Indonesia has in common with traditional retail in Thailand namely direct competition with large retail modern. Thai government's response is to publish specific legislation in the field of retail as well as the Code of Ethics. Direct competition between traditional retail and modern large in Indonesia occurred as it relates to the effectiveness of regulation and zoning, rules of opening hours, lack of competence and management of market traders, and also relates to the weakness of the Commission's scope of authority and a lack of effective enforcement of legal protection.
Based on the problems identified previously, for the ASEAN Economic Community is necessary to strengthen the authority of the Commission and revision of Law No. 5 of 1999. In addition, to improve the bargaining position of Indonesian traditional retailers should have an association or associations that can respond to the problems faced.

"Indonesia will be welcoming the ASEAN Economic Community in 2015 as a multilateral agreement
to create integrated regions such as: (a) a single market and production base, (b) a highly
competitive economic region, (c) a region of equitable economic development, and (d) a region
fully integrated into the global economy. These characteristics are interrelated and mutually
reinforcing in a sense that overall development would not be complete without total completion
of the previous sector. This article discusses the participation of Indonesia as part of ASEAN as a
single market and production base, through free flow of services which targets higher education
in law. The author researched that Indonesian higher education system still faces issues, especially
in legal education. As a result, the quality of Indonesian law graduate still varies. Indonesian legal
education is special in nature since it is considered profession and regulated by code of ethic.
According to the author, legal education should be integrated with profession organization so
that upon graduation, law graduates can directly conduct internship according to their desired
profession and compete against ASEAN law graduates.
Indonesia akan menghadapi ASEAN Economic Commmunity pada tahun 2015 sebagai realisasi
perjanjian multilateral untuk menciptakan wilayah terintegrasi seperti: (a) pusat produksi dan
pasar tunggal, (b) wilayah ekonomi yang kompetitif, (c) wilayah yang memiliki perkembangan
ekonomi yang memadai, dan (d) wilayah yang terintegrasi dengan ekonomi global. Karakteristik
ini saling berhubungan dan mendukung dalam arti semua perkembangan ini tidak akan lengkap
tanpa terpenuhinya semua persyaratan tersebut. Artikel ini membahas partisipasi Indonesia
sebagai anggota ASEAN mengenai potensi pendidikan tinggi dalam bidang hukum sebagai sektor
jasa. Akibatnya kualitas lulusan hukum di Indonesia masih beraneka ragam secara nasional.
Pendidikan hukum itu sifatnya khusus karena berupa profesi dan diatur oleh kode etik. Menurut
hemat penulis, seharusnya pendidikan hukum terintegrasi dengan lembaga profesi, sehingga
lulusan sarjana hukum sudah memiliki sertifikasi untuk langsung magang menurut profesinya
masing-masing dan bersaing dengan lulusan hukum dari ASEAN."
